If ` vec a\ a n d\ vec b` represent two adjacent sides of a parallel then write vectors representing its diagonals.

Text Solution

Verified by Experts

Considering a parallelogram `ABCD`
we see
`vec{A B}=vec{A^{prime} B^{prime}}=vec{a} cdot vec{A A^{prime}}=vec{B B^{prime}}=vec{b} cdot vec{A B^{prime}}=vec{c} text { and } vec{B A^{prime}}=vec{d}`
Using parallelogram law of vector addition, we can say that
`vec{a}+vec{b}=vec{c} text { and } vec{a}+vec{d}=vec{b} text { or } vec{d}=vec{b}-vec{a}`
Also, `vec{c}` and `vec{d}` are the diagonals of the parallelogram.
